Blue Rhino, in March of this year, and the Federal Trade Commission and AmeriGas, in November of last year, reached a consent agreement. There are several similarities between the two agreements, and both sets of companies will pay a combined $3.5 million in penalties. On the handle, near the valve, the manufacture date should be written somewhere. The majority of the time, it is written in a standard Month-Year format. If your tank was built in June 2020, it would be spelled “06-20.” Tanks are also stamped with a unique identification code, similar to how vehicles are.

Inflationary pressures, including the volatile costs of steel, diesel fuel, and propane, have had a significant impact on the cylinder exchange industry. In 2008, to help control these rising costs, Blue Rhino followed the example of other consumer products companies with a product content change. We reduced the amount of propane in our tanks from 17 pounds to 15 pounds. In addition to refilling propane tanks, Costco provides tire service at its tire center. Blue Rhino is not only installing OPD valves, they are installing their OWN proprietary OPD valves, called Tri-Safe II valves. You can identify a TSII valve by the little triangular indentation on the side of the valve.
